Attic find by [deleted] in violinmaking

[–]ellegin 6 points7 points  (0 children)

This is a genuine Strad 1723 the "Edler, McCormack, Healy"

The b stings on the back, sap stains and two piece opio maple back pointed me to mid 1720s and a quick reference to Tarisio pointed me to the record. The tailpiece confirmed the guess.

It has long lineage of noble and artist so it would surprise me that this violin would be lost recently and "rediscovered" in an "attic."

West German Violin by CupBoundAndDown in ViolinIdentification

[–]ellegin 0 points1 point  (0 children)

$3,000-8,000 for an Ernst Heinrich Roth. I can't be more certain without pics of the scroll but it looks real. EHR has different grades 1R-10R (IR-XR) and on discussion occasions XIR for special artists commissions. This in my opinion looks maybe in the range of IIIR-VIIR.
